Yellow corals seem to be some of the hardest to find. That's one color that I don't see as much of. What are some of your favorite yellow corals?

24k lepto
Yellow fiji leather
Yellow hammer (there are some highlighter yellow ones vs coppery/gold)
King midas zoa's
Bright yellow Monti like asd phoenix or kung pow
